Could this error be caused by using the older GSHHS data set instead of the newer GSHHG? I, too, have the same pscoast issue on Ubuntu 14.04, and noticed that GSHHG is presently unavailable in the Ubuntu repositories. Thus the current GMT build is using the older coastline/land/border data files. Robert S. Linzell QinetiQ North America, Inc.
